Well I guess you have to have a use for a mobile robot before you go out and buy one - then you already know what you want it for. Lots of them go to commercial companies to build applications on top of, or to universities so they can do research into autonomous vehicles etc -- think DARPA grand challenge on a smaller scale. It's basically a development platform so it's for you to write the software, but for a commercial grade robot the nearest competitor is over twice the price.
